Author: colossus
Date: 2006-11-22 13:38:24 +0000 (Wed, 22 Nov 2006)
New Revision: 23932

Modified:
   xarchiver/trunk/pixmaps/Makefile.am
   xarchiver/trunk/src/callbacks.c
   xarchiver/trunk/src/support.c
Log:
Workaround for finding the xarchiver window icon; still to be fixed.
Fixed missed deletion of socket file when closing xarchiver.


Modified: xarchiver/trunk/pixmaps/Makefile.am
===================================================================
--- xarchiver/trunk/pixmaps/Makefile.am 2006-11-22 13:15:06 UTC (rev 23931)
+++ xarchiver/trunk/pixmaps/Makefile.am 2006-11-22 13:38:24 UTC (rev 23932)
@@ -1,10 +1,7 @@
-pixmapdir = $(pkgdatadir)/pixmaps
-pixmap_DATA =                  \
-       add.png                 \
-       add_button.png          \
-       extract.png             \
-       extract_button.png      \
-       close.png
+# Inspired by Makefile.am from the Thunar file-manager
 
-EXTRA_DIST =                                                           \
-       $(pixmap_DATA)
+pixmapsdir = $(datadir)/pixmaps/xarchiver
+
+pixmaps_DATA = add.png extract.png close.png add_button.png extract_button.png
+
+EXTRA_DIST = $(pixmaps_DATA)

Modified: xarchiver/trunk/src/callbacks.c
===================================================================
--- xarchiver/trunk/src/callbacks.c     2006-11-22 13:15:06 UTC (rev 23931)
+++ xarchiver/trunk/src/callbacks.c     2006-11-22 13:38:24 UTC (rev 23932)
@@ -551,6 +551,9 @@
        if (current_open_directory != NULL)
                g_free (current_open_directory);
 
+#ifdef HAVE_SOCKET
+       socket_finalize();
+#endif
        gtk_main_quit();
 }
 

Modified: xarchiver/trunk/src/support.c
===================================================================
--- xarchiver/trunk/src/support.c       2006-11-22 13:15:06 UTC (rev 23931)
+++ xarchiver/trunk/src/support.c       2006-11-22 13:38:24 UTC (rev 23932)
@@ -32,7 +32,7 @@
        gchar *path;
        GdkPixbuf *file_pixbuf = NULL;
 
-       path = g_strconcat("/usr/share/", "/xarchiver/pixmaps/", filename, 
NULL);
+       path = g_strconcat("/usr/share/icons/48x48/", filename, NULL);
        file_pixbuf = gdk_pixbuf_new_from_file (path, &error);
        g_free (path);
        if ( file_pixbuf == NULL )

_______________________________________________
Xfce4-commits mailing list
[email protected]
http://foo-projects.org/mailman/listinfo/xfce4-commits

Reply via email to